Output ec220c86f17874217583027cba52df22cad71c4c2389fa9b9ebd90632f2f8734:78

value
63172
script pubkey
OP_0 OP_PUSHBYTES_32 77878b7e9f4735416f67f4d7ee346363a0b4e0a8a0d9e8eb5a65ef4c1e0964df
address
bc1qw7rckl5lgu65zmm87nt7udrrvwstfc9g5rv73666vhh5c8sfvn0sph4l48
transaction
ec220c86f17874217583027cba52df22cad71c4c2389fa9b9ebd90632f2f8734